The R&D World Index (RDWI) for the week ending May 10, 2024, closed at 3,563.72 for the 25 companies in the RDWI. The Index was up 1.51% (or 52.86 basis points). Eighteen RDWI members gained value last week from 0.18% (Stellantis NV) to 5.34% (Meta Platforms). Seven RDWI members lost value the previous week from…

George Clooney is set to make his Broadway debut as the legendary reporter and anchor Edward R. Murrow. It’s for the stage production of his 2005 movie “Good Night, and Good Luck.” The show is set to open spring 2025.
